HUNTINGTON, NY — A Huntington delicatessen is serving up more than just traditional sandwiches as the new coronavirus spreads and people across Long Island struggle to find everyday household goods. In a sure sign of the times, customers can head to Blue Line Deli & Bagels for toilet paper, bottles of water and paper towels — and perhaps buy lunch while they're at it.

Donald Rosner, 38, who owns the deli at 719 W. Jericho Turnpike, knew there was a problem when he took a trip to King Kullen a week ago to buy store supplies and was met with empty shelves.

"They had nothing," Rosner told Patch. "Having two kids at home, if I wasn't able to get toilet paper, that'd be a massive problem for me."

Rosner found he was still able to procure goods for his deli through a longtime supplier during his time working for Bagel Boss, a franchise his family is still very much involved with. Hoping to help others find supplies, Rosner decided to start selling them at the same price he pays his supplier.

"We've been offering at cost for people in the neighborhood and trying to help out, because I can't stand people who gouge prices," he said. "When there's a crisis, people need help; they don't need to get their wallets stolen from them."
